[continued from previous message]
from ‘RefPtr<T>::~RefPtr() [with T = mozilla::dom::IDBTransaction]’<br>/<<PKGBUILDDIR>>/build-browser/dom/bindings/IDBDatabaseBinding.cpp:248:59: required from here<br>/<<PKGBUILDDIR>>/build-browser/dist/include/
mozilla/RefPtr.h:42:11: error: request for member ‘Release’ is ambiguous<br> 42 | aPtr->Release();<br> | ~~~~~~^~~~~~~<br>In file included from /<<PKGBUILDDIR>>/build-browser/dist/include/nsISupportsUtils.h:11,<
from /<<PKGBUILDDIR>>/build-browser/dist/include/nsCOMPtr.h:30,<br> from /<<PKGBUILDDIR>>/build-browser/dist/include/nsAutoPtr.h:10,<br> from /<<
PKGBUILDDIR>>/build-browser/dist/include/mozilla/OwningNonNull.h:12,<br> from /<<PKGBUILDDIR>>/build-browser/dist/include/mozilla/RootedOwningNonNull.h:20,<br> from /<<PKGBUILDDIR&
gt;>/build-browser/dist/include/mozilla/dom/BindingDeclarations.h:20,<br> from /<<PKGBUILDDIR>>/build-browser/dist/include/mozilla/dom/BindingUtils.h:18,<br> from /<<PKGBUILDDIR>&
gt;/build-browser/dist/include/mozilla/dom/GeneratedAtomList.h:6,<br> from /<<PKGBUILDDIR>>/dom/bindings/AtomList.h:11,<br> from /<<PKGBUILDDIR>>/build-browser/dom/bindings/
HTMLSlotElementBinding.cpp:3,<br> from /<<PKGBUILDDIR>>/build-browser/dom/bindings/UnifiedBindings8.cpp:2:<br>/<<PKGBUILDDIR>>/build-browser/dist/include/nsISupportsBase.h:76:40: note: candidates are: ‘
virtual MozExternalRefCountType nsISupports::Release()’<br> 76 | NS_IMETHOD_(MozExternalRefCountType) Release(void) = 0;<br> | ^~~~~~~<br>In file included from /<<
PKGBUILDDIR>>/build-browser/dist/include/nsISupportsUtils.h:14,<br> from /<<PKGBUILDDIR>>/build-browser/dist/include/nsCOMPtr.h:30,<br> from /<<PKGBUILDDIR>>/build-browser/
dist/include/nsAutoPtr.h:10,<br> from /<<PKGBUILDDIR>>/build-browser/dist/include/mozilla/OwningNonNull.h:12,<br> from /<<PKGBUILDDIR>>/build-browser/dist/include/mozilla/
RootedOwningNonNull.h:20,<br> from /<<PKGBUILDDIR>>/build-browser/dist/include/mozilla/dom/BindingDeclarations.h:20,<br> from /<<PKGBUILDDIR>>/build-browser/dist/include/mozilla/
dom/BindingUtils.h:18,<br> from /<<PKGBUILDDIR>>/build-browser/dist/include/mozilla/dom/GeneratedAtomList.h:6,<br> from /<<PKGBUILDDIR>>/dom/bindings/AtomList.h:11,<br> �
� from /<<PKGBUILDDIR>>/build-browser/dom/bindings/HTMLSlotElementBinding.cpp:3,<br> from /<<PKGBUILDDIR>>/build-browser/dom/bindings/UnifiedBindings8.cpp:2:<br>/<<PKGBUILDDIR>>/
build-browser/dist/include/nsISupportsImpl.h:1133:40: note: ‘virtual MozExternalRefCountType mozilla::dom::IDBWrapperCache::Release()’<br> 1133 | NS_IMETHOD_(MozExternalRefCountType) Release(void) override; �
�\<br> | ^~~~~~~<br>/<<PKGBUILDDIR>>/build-browser/dist/include/mozilla/dom/IDBWrapperCache.h:25:3: note: in expansion of macro ‘NS_DECL_ISUPPORTS_INHERITED’<br> 25 | �
� NS_DECL_ISUPPORTS_INHERITED<br> | ^~~~~~~~~~~~~~~~~~~~~~~~~~~<br>In file included from /<<PKGBUILDDIR>>/build-browser/dom/bindings/IDBDatabaseBinding.cpp:16,<br> from /<<PKGBUILDDIR>>/build-
browser/dom/bindings/UnifiedBindings8.cpp:302:<br>/<<PKGBUILDDIR>>/build-browser/dist/include/mozilla/dom/IDBTransaction.h:129:3: warning: ‘already_AddRefed<mozilla::dom::IDBTransaction> mozilla::dom::Create(JSContext*, mozilla::dom::
IDBDatabase*, const nsTArray<nsTString<char16_t> >&, int)’ declared ‘static’ but never defined [-Wunused-function]<br> 129 | Create(JSContext* aCx, IDBDatabase* aDatabase,<br> | ^~~~~~<br>/<<PKGBUILDDIR>>/
build-browser/dist/include/mozilla/dom/IDBTransaction.h:134:3: warning: ‘mozilla::dom::IDBTransaction* mozilla::dom::GetCurrent()’ declared ‘static’ but never defined [-Wunused-function]<br> 134 | GetCurrent();<br> | ^~~~~~~~~~<br>
In file included from /<<PKGBUILDDIR>>/build-browser/dist/include/jsapi.h:17,<br> from /<<PKGBUILDDIR>>/dom/bindings/AtomList.h:10,<br> from /<<PKGBUILDDIR>>/build-
browser/dom/bindings/HTMLSlotElementBinding.cpp:3,<br> from /<<PKGBUILDDIR>>/build-browser/dom/bindings/UnifiedBindings8.cpp:2:<br>/<<PKGBUILDDIR>>/build-browser/dist/include/mozilla/RefPtr.h: In
instantiation of ‘static void mozilla::RefPtrTraits<U>::Release(U*) [with U = mozilla::dom::StrongWorkerRef]’:<br>/<<PKGBUILDDIR>>/build-browser/dist/include/mozilla/RefPtr.h:407:40: required from ‘static void RefPtr<T>::
ConstRemovingRefPtrTraits<U>::Release(U*) [with U = mozilla::dom::StrongWorkerRef; T = mozilla::dom::StrongWorkerRef]’<br>/<<PKGBUILDDIR>>/build-browser/dist/include/mozilla/RefPtr.h:80:44: required from ‘RefPtr<T>::~RefPtr(
) [with T = mozilla::dom::StrongWorkerRef]’<br>/<<PKGBUILDDIR>>/build-browser/dist/include/mozilla/dom/IDBTransaction.h:84:27: required from here<br>/<<PKGBUILDDIR>>/build-browser/dist/include/mozilla/RefPtr.h:42:11: error:
invalid use of incomplete type ‘class mozilla::dom::StrongWorkerRef’<br> 42 | aPtr->Release();<br> | ~~~~~~^~~~~~~<br>In file included from /<<PKGBUILDDIR>>/build-browser/dist/include/mozilla/dom/
ExtendableMessageEventBinding.h:12,<br> from /<<PKGBUILDDIR>>/build-browser/dist/include/mozilla/dom/UnionConversions.h:20,<br> from /<<PKGBUILDDIR>>/build-browser/dom/bindings/
HeadersBinding.cpp:15,<br> from /<<PKGBUILDDIR>>/build-browser/dom/bindings/UnifiedBindings8.cpp:230:<br>/<<PKGBUILDDIR>>/build-browser/dist/include/mozilla/dom/MessagePort.h:29:7: note: forward
declaration of ‘class mozilla::dom::StrongWorkerRef’<br> 29 | class StrongWorkerRef;<br> | ^~~~~~~~~~~~~~~<br>make[5]: *** [/<<PKGBUILDDIR>>/config/<a href="
http://rules.mk:1033">rules.mk:1033</a>: UnifiedBindings8.o]
Error 1<br>make[5]: Leaving directory '/<<PKGBUILDDIR>>/build-browser/dom/bindings'<br>make[4]: *** [/<<PKGBUILDDIR>>/config/<a href="
http://recurse.mk:74">recurse.mk:74</a>: dom/bindings/target] Error 2<br>make[4]:
Leaving directory '/<<PKGBUILDDIR>>/build-browser'<br>make[3]: *** [/<<PKGBUILDDIR>>/config/<a href="
http://recurse.mk:34">recurse.mk:34</a>: compile] Error 2<br>make[3]: Leaving directory '/<<PKGBUILDDIR>>/
build-browser'<br>make[2]: *** [/<<PKGBUILDDIR>>/config/<a href="
http://rules.mk:418">rules.mk:418</a>: default] Error 2<br>make[2]: Leaving directory '/<<PKGBUILDDIR>>/build-browser'<br>dh_auto_build: error: cd build-
browser && make -j1 LD_LIBS=-Wl,--no-gc-sections _LEAKTEST_FILES=leaktest.py returned exit code 2<br>make[1]: *** [debian/rules:216: stamps/build-browser] Error 25<br>make[1]: Leaving directory '/<<PKGBUILDDIR>>'<br>make: *** [
debian/rules:321: build-arch] Error 2<br>dpkg-buildpackage: error: debian/rules build-arch subprocess returned exit status 2<br>--------------------------------------------------------------------------------<br>Build finished at 2021-11-28T14:33:43Z</
<div><br></div><div><br></div><br><div><br></div><div><br></div><div><br></div><div><br></div></div></div>
--- SoupGate-Win32 v1.05
* Origin: fsxNet Usenet Gateway (21:1/5)